    I would like to start by saying that my wife, my daughter and myself purchased a manufactured home…read morefrom Mobile Homes on Main in April of 2022. Initially the transaction was great. But soon after my down payment of 20K was accepted I was told that I needed to put another 10K down in order for the financing to receive approval. Per their sales person Heather Whalen I needed to secure a general contractor from their approved contractors lost to place the manufactured home on a lot that I owned. Well I interviewed 7 general contractors and even had them visit my property site, but none them was willing to do the job. These actions motivated me to call and speak to my sales person, Heather Whalen to inform her of the results of my contractor search, but I was informed that she had left the company. I was put in touch with the GM John Soderberg and this is when my dream turned into a horrible nightmare. I apprised Mr. Soderberg of my dilemma and asked him for a refund of my deposit and he said that Mobile Homes on Main was in the business of selling and delivering manufactured homes. He then told me that I would lose my total deposit of $31,000.00 and that I should read the contract carefully. Well this response from him prompted me to seek legal advice. Upon review of the contract by my attorney, he advised me that if he had reviewed the contract prior to me signing it, he would have advised against signing it. My attorney also stated that per the contract I didn't have a leg to stand on legally because the contract did not have a clause to allow the buyer to get out of it for any reason. I must say at this point I felt like my family and I had been raped financially. No matter what I said to John he refused to budge on retuning us our full deposit. So I asked him to return one half of our deposit and he said that he would consider that, but would have to check with his corporate office because he said that as a GM he could only recommend this proposal. Fast forward 6 weeks to January 2023 I began calling the escrow company and the corporate office to confirm if John had submitted our proposal for approval and they informed me that he had not submitted it yet. So some two weeks later I received a call from the regional manager of Mobile Homes on Main or their parent company, Kris Durham. Kris was the complete opposite of John Soderberg, he was kind, considerate and apologized for how we had been treated. Kris said that he would do his best to have our deposit returned to us. Well Kris was a man of his word and he delivered to us almost all of our deposit minus $5000.00 Great Job and thank you Kris. Now let's talk about the rest of our deposit. We did everything humanly possible to make this transaction a success. This transaction failed because of Mobile Homes on Main and their lack of professionalism in vetting their "approved contractors." Therefore as an act of excellent customer service we request the return of the remaining Portion of our initial deposit.
